Push the Drum Major trolley close to the drum. Hook both sliding rim grabs over the drum top rim. (Note that you have a choice of long or short grabs according to the drum rim thickness).
As you pull the drum back towards you, place your foot on the lower axle and push the trolley feet under the drum at the same time until the drum is loaded. Remove your foot from the axle.
Important Note: Be very sure that the drum feet are UNDER the drum, as they may puncture the drum otherwise.
Pull the trolley handles down until the drum is sitting on all four wheels and balanced. When turning, raise the small wheels off the floor slightly.
Fit a tap to the 50 mm bung, and have the bung face you when loading the drum onto the trolley.
Pull the Drum Major handles all the way down to the horizontal position until the axle moves past vertical under spring pressure. To stop the trolley from moving, apply the brake (lever all the way down).
Place a 20 or 25 Ltr pail under the tap and decant as much product as you need. You may need to undo the small bung now at the top of the drum, in order to introduce air into the drum.
If the drum position is not correct for decanting, or if there is a leak, simply rotate the drum to another position. You will need to remove the drum rim grabs in order to rotate the drum. Remember to replace them prior to tipping the drum back up.
Make sure that the brake is on, and the rim grabs are over the drum rim, then push the trolley forward. As you do so, the front left hand wheel will lock up and the axle will begin to fold back under the trolley.
At the four or two-wheeled angled position, release the brake (pull up to horizontal). The Drum Major can now be wheeled around as before.
Simply push the top of the handles into the drum space, and the feet will pop out. Remove the drum rim grabs and the trolley is then free of the drum.
The Drum Major requires a solid fulcrum point, so the drum must be inside the pallet by 25 mm (1″) at all times.
To load, simply push the drum trolley in the four wheeled position straight into the pallet until it stops. Keeping forward pressure against the pallet at all times, simply raise the Drum Major handles until the drum is on the pallet. To remove the trolley, push the handles into the drum space in order to pop the feet out. Remove the drum rim grabs.
To unload, make sure that the drum is inside the pallet by 25 mm. Position the trolley feet close to the drum, then place the drum rim grabs over the top rim of the drum. Pull back whilst pushing the trolley feet under the drum using pressure from your foot on the lower axle.
With the drum completely on the trolley. Keep pulling back until the trolley is sliding down the face of the pallet with the drum on it.

Q: What is a drum trolley used for?
A: A drum trolley is used to safely transport 205L drums across a worksite. The King Multipurpose Drum Trolley can also tilt and cradle drums for decanting.
Q: Can this trolley handle both steel and plastic drums?
A: Yes. As long as the drum has a rim suitable for gripping, this trolley works with both steel and plastic 205L drums.
Q: Does the trolley hold the drum upright during movement?
A: Yes. The trolley supports the drum in an upright position for transport and includes a cradle for horizontal support when decanting.
Q: Can I pour from a drum using this trolley?
A: Absolutely. The tilt function and cradle design make it easy to decant liquids from a drum safely and without needing extra equipment.
Q: What is the weight capacity of this trolley?
A: It’s built to handle standard 205L drums, typically weighing up to 300kg when full.
Q: Is this trolley easy to move when loaded?
A: Yes. The heavy-duty castors and balanced design make it surprisingly easy to manoeuvre even when fully loaded.
Q: Will it damage my floor?
A: No. The wheels are non-marking and designed for smooth rolling across concrete, tiles, or sealed flooring.
Q: Do I need training to use the drum trolley?
A: No special training is required, but basic manual handling knowledge is always recommended for safe operation.
